Collection of canning company record books

  • CA ON00156 2020-091
  • Collection
  • 1911-1928

Collection of account books, primarily relating to Hastings County canning companies:

  1. Frankford Canning and Preserving Company Limited

    1. Record book (incorporation, by-laws, register of directors and shareholders), 1911-1912
    2. Minute book, 1911-1917
    3. Invoices issued, 1922-1923
    4. Unpaid invoices, 1922-1923
  2. Foxboro Canning Company Limited

    1. Record book (incorporation, by-laws, register of directors and shareholders), 1912-1917
  3. Trent Valley Canners Limited

    1. Record book (incorporation, by-laws, register of directors and shareholders), 1913-1914 [insect damaged]
    2. Minute book, 1913-1917
  4. Barr Registers Limited [Trenton]

    1. Register of sales and payments, 1920-1924
    2. File of correspondence concerning claim for non-payment against W. R. & K. Morrison of Cleveland, Nova Scotia, 1924-1928

Plan of the village of Frankford (Evans and Bolger tracing)

A certified reproduction of the Plan of the Village of Frankford, being parts of Lots # 2, 3, 4, 5, & 6 in the 5th Concession of the Township of Sidney. A certified tracing of the Evans & Bolger Plan (circa 1877), made by W. S. Drewry, P. L. S. Signed by Henry Carre, P.L.S.

This copy was made in 1972 of plan #137, as registered in the Hastings Land Registry Office.

Donated by Walter I. Watson, O.L.S.

Plan of Turley Property in the village of Frankford

A certified reproduction of the Plan of part of the Village of Frankford - the property of Patrick Turley Esq. Surveyed by J. S. Peterson, P.L.S. and signed May, 1855.

This copy was made in 1972 of plan #88, as registered in the Hastings Land Registry Office.

Donated by Walter I. Watson, O.L.S.

Plan of park lots on Lot 6 in Frankford

A certified reproduction of the Plan of survey of Park lots on Lot # 6 in 5th Concession of Sidney Township (Frankford). Lot # 2 is reserved for Church of England Parsonage at south west corner. Surveyed by J. S. Peterson, P.L.S. and signed December 23, 1852.

This copy was made in 1972 of plan #73, as registered in the Hastings Land Registry Office.

Donated by Walter I. Watson, O.L.S.

Plan of village lots on Lot 7 in the Township of Sidney

A certified reproduction of the Plan shewing the survey of village lots on Lot # 7 in 5th Concession of Sidney Township (Frankford). Shows route of Junction Railroad through village. Surveyed by J. S. Peterson, P.L.S. in May of 1855.

This copy was made in 1972 of plan #89, as registered in the Hastings Land Registry Office.

Donated by Walter I. Watson, O.L.S.

Subdivision of part of Block 23 in the village of Frankford

A certified reproduction of the "Village of Frankford, subdivision of parts of Block 23 and Lots # 2-3 on [the] west side of Scott Street.” The area surveyed includes; both sides of Finnegan Drive between the Canadian National Railway and Scott Street. Surveyed by Fraser Aylsworth Jr., O. L. S. and signed September 29, 1925.

This copy was made in 1972 of plan #552, as registered in the Hastings Land Registry Office.

Donated by Walter I. Watson, P. L. S.

Plan of part of the village of Frankford

A certified reproduction of a "Plan...of the village of Frankford. ” The area includes; part of Frankford Village westerly from King St. to Lots # 1-2 in Sidney Township and northerly from Sidney Street to Adelaide Street, including Cold Creek. Dated April 1853. Surveyed by J. S. Peterson, P.L.S.

This reproduction was made on April 9, 1981 and approved by the Land Registrar.

Donated by Walter I. Watson, P. L. S.
